Undergraduate Student Researcher at Tufts University School of Medicine
The principal research conducted in my lab concerns epilepsy it causes, and how we cure it. I contribute to this mission by conducting mouse surgeries designed to place head mounts on the mouse brain to later read electrical activity on an EEG. Later on, these devices are employed when inducing seizures in mice, and then injecting these same mice with an anticonvulsant drug to see if seizures are suppressed. Additionally, I perform the steps required to image mouse brains and perform data analysis on these images.
